- [ ] **Key Ceremony Step 3 — Offline Mode Keys (Surveybird Field App).** Verify the offline sync bundle for Surveybird is signed before field tablets leave the Marrowgate depot; unsigned bundles will refuse to cache survey plots. Both ceremony officers must confirm the checksum aloud and log it for the eng sync notes. Then unlock the signing enclave with the recovery passphrase below.

recovery phrase for bawif-yawif: gorwyn-kelix-zorox-silath-novix-juleth

## Runbook: Firmware Channel Stall — Ferrowave Hub

If devices on the beta channel stop receiving updates, first check the channel manifest age; anything older than six hours means the signer job on the Quillbrook cluster has stalled. Restart the signer, then force a manifest rebuild. Do not switch devices to the stable channel as a workaround. The channel service must be running with exactly these settings.

deployment values, yafof-tawig:
quenath:
  log_level: info
  metrics_host: metrics.quenath.zemvarsys.internal
  pin: 5568
  pool_size: 8

INTERNAL MEMO — Board of Directors

Re: Potential acquisition of Glenmara Analytics

Management has completed preliminary diligence on Glenmara. Their modeling suite complements our Harrowfield platform, and retention of their engineering team appears feasible. Valuation discussions remain early; we recommend authorizing a non-binding indication of interest. Risks include integration cost and one pending licensing dispute. The strategic rationale is set out in the confidential note below.

internal memo for kawip-hadug: Headcount on the Wenwyn team goes from 7 to 140 by the end of January. Gross margin on Wenwyn came in at 20 percent against a plan of 15 percent.